Transaction 057aa93ed062dd7246458fd3b210104c95c932aa81af7124b487eb43ada465a3

2 Input
2 Outputs
  • 057aa93ed062dd7246458fd3b210104c95c932aa81af7124b487eb43ada465a3:0
  • value  414702
    address  3H32PThQPWSKjodf2koFy2ohqFZefqhKhb
  • 057aa93ed062dd7246458fd3b210104c95c932aa81af7124b487eb43ada465a3:1
  • value  990068
    address  bc1qhjew8644pgkz8f2h8w5vwk2judswrnpdrmcxy7